We are witnessing the sick relationship between the United States and Israel. — Egyptian podcaster Rahma Zain The outpouring of support for Palestine around the world in recent weeks has been a very encouraging sight. Dotted with signs calling for “Freedom For Palestine,” “Ceasefire Now,” and “We Are All Palestinians,” protests burst forth in London, […]
Source